• Set the CAM/OFF/VIDEO switch to VIDEO.
• Set the television to the camcorder channel (3 or 4)
depending upon the selected channel in the RF channel
select switch of RF converter unit.
• When you see the playback picture on your TV, adjust fine
tuning knob on television set to obtain best picture.
• TV receiver is older type. It needs to be modified to work
properly with camcorder.
• Tape is damaged. Try another cassette.
• TV set has VIR circuit. Turn it off during playback.
